Tolinase is a medication that is used to treat type 2 diabetes. It helps to lower blood sugar levels by increasing the amount of insulin produced by the pancreas. Some synonyms for the word Tolinase are generic names like tolazamide, tolbutamide, and chlorpropamide. These medications work in a similar way to Tolinase by stimulating the production of insulin in the pancreas. In addition to these, other medications like Glucophage, Glynase, and Glimepiride also work to lower blood sugar levels. These medications are commonly prescribed to those who have failed to achieve adequate blood sugar control with other treatment options. It is important to follow the prescribed dosage and directions of any medication taken to manage diabetes.
